The argument over which Victorian community football league is the best in the state may finally be settled, in the inaugural WorkSafe AFL Victoria Community Championships.
For the first time, metropolitan and country leagues will battle it out for the ultimate bragging rights to be crowned the premier community football league in Victoria.
In the initial year of the Championships, leagues have been fixtured against each other in a manner which will assist in the official ranking of leagues for the following year and beyond.
The opportunity to play senior representative football has been enjoyed by Victorian country leagues in the WorkSafe AFL Victoria Country Championship for many years, while metropolitan leagues have welcomed the return of representative football as part of the Metropolitan Championships since 2014.
